Why These Are the Top Insulation Contractors in Mcminnville

** The insulation market in Mcminnville, TN, is characterized by a moderate level of competition, primarily from regional contractors and specialized franchises that cover the broader Middle Tennessee area. There are few, if any, insulation providers with a physical storefront located directly within Mcminnville city limits, so residents typically rely on these mobile service companies from neighboring cities like Manchester, Lewisburg, and Murfreesboro. The average quality of service is good, with several providers holding relevant certifications (e.g., from Insulation Institute) and demonstrating strong knowledge of local climate challenges. Pricing is generally in line with regional averages. For blown-in attic insulation, homeowners can expect prices in the range of **$1,500 - $3,500** for a standard project. Spray foam is a premium option, typically costing **$3,500 - $7,500+** depending on the area covered and foam type. Many providers are well-versed in potential rebates from the TVA Energy Right program, which can help offset costs for qualifying energy efficiency upgrades. The market is not oversaturated, allowing reputable companies to maintain high standards of customer service and workmanship.

Frequently Asked Questions About Insulation in Mcminnville

Get answers to common questions about insulation services in Mcminnville, Tennessee.

1What is the recommended R-value for attic insulation in McMinnville, TN homes?

For our climate zone (Zone 4), the U.S. Department of Energy recommends an attic R-value of R49 to R60. This is crucial for McMinnville's humid subtropical climate, with hot, humid summers and cool winters, to effectively manage heat gain and loss. Properly achieving this R-value typically requires adding to existing insulation, often with blown-in cellulose or fiberglass.

2When is the best time of year to install or upgrade insulation in McMinnville?

The ideal times are late spring (April-May) and early fall (September-October). These periods offer milder temperatures, making it more comfortable for contractors to work in your attic and allowing for proper ventilation during installation. Scheduling during these shoulder seasons also helps you prepare your home for the peak heating and cooling demands of our Tennessee summer and winter.

3Are there any local rebates or incentives for insulation upgrades in Warren County?

Yes, McMinnville residents should first check for rebates directly from the Middle Tennessee Electric Membership Corporation (MTEMC). Additionally, federal tax credits for insulation are available through the Inflation Reduction Act, which can cover 30% of the project cost up to a $1,200 annual limit. Always verify current program details with your installer and utility provider.

4How do I choose a reliable insulation contractor in the McMinnville area?

Select a contractor licensed and insured in Tennessee, and ask for local references from recent projects in Warren County. A reputable provider will perform a thorough energy audit or assessment to identify specific air leaks and insulation gaps common in local home construction, rather than offering a one-size-fits-all solution. Check their familiarity with local building codes and moisture barriers, which are vital for our region's humidity.

5Besides the attic, what are the most critical areas to insulate for energy efficiency in our climate?

In McMinnville, sealing and insulating the crawl space is paramount due to high ground moisture, which can lead to mold, wood rot, and cold floors. Properly insulating basement walls (if applicable) and band joists is also highly effective. Finally, air sealing around windows, doors, and ductwork in the conditioned space is a cost-effective step to complement bulk insulation and combat both summer humidity and winter drafts.
